UK Tech, Models & Russia's Conflict: A Complex Interplay

The conflict in Ukraine has dramatically reshaped the global landscape, impacting various sectors, including the UK's thriving technology industry and its intricate relationship with international models and Russian interests. This article explores the multifaceted consequences of this conflict, examining its impact on tech investments, supply chains, data security, and the ethical considerations surrounding international collaborations.

The Ripple Effect on UK Tech Investment

The war in Ukraine has created significant uncertainty in global markets, impacting investor confidence and consequently affecting UK tech investment. Geopolitical risk has become a primary concern, leading some investors to adopt a more cautious approach. This is particularly true for companies with significant exposure to Eastern European markets or those reliant on Russian resources. The energy crisis, fuelled by the conflict, has also added to economic instability, indirectly impacting investment in UK tech startups and established businesses.

Impact on Specific Sectors

The impact isn't uniform across all tech sectors. For example, cybersecurity firms are experiencing increased demand due to heightened concerns about state-sponsored cyberattacks and disinformation campaigns. Conversely, sectors reliant on Russian components or supply chains may face disruptions and increased costs. The UK government's response, including sanctions and investment incentives, is playing a crucial role in mitigating the negative consequences and fostering resilience within the tech sector.

Data Security and National Security Concerns

The war in Ukraine has highlighted the vulnerability of critical infrastructure to cyberattacks. The UK, as a significant player in the global tech landscape, is particularly concerned about protecting its national security interests from potential state-sponsored cyber threats emanating from Russia or its allies. This has led to increased investment in cybersecurity measures and a greater focus on data protection regulations.

Strengthening Cyber Defenses

The UK government is working closely with the private sector to bolster national cybersecurity. This includes initiatives to improve threat intelligence sharing, strengthen critical infrastructure protection, and promote best practices for data security. The emphasis is on proactive measures to prevent and mitigate potential attacks, ensuring the resilience of UK tech infrastructure in the face of ongoing geopolitical uncertainty.
